Item 5.02 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ers.

On July 13, 2026, the Board of Directors (the “Board”) of CoStar Group, Inc. (the “Company” or “CoStar Group”) appointed Robin Rossmann to serve as the Company’s Chief Financial Officer, effective July 31, 2026 (“Effective Date”). Mr. Rossmann, 45, who currently serves as the Company’s Managing Director, Europe, and is a member of the Company's executive leadership team, brings more than 20 years of financial, operational and strategic leadership experience to the role of Chief Financial Officer. Over his nearly seven years with the Company, Mr. Rossmann has led several of CoStar Group’s businesses internationally, distinguished himself by dramatically improving the margins of CoStar Group's European business while delivering double-digit revenue growth and launching CoStar in France. Rossmann joined STR in 2016, leading its businesses across EMEA, Asia Pacific and Latin America, and became part of CoStar Group through the Company's acquisition of STR in 2019. Over the past decade with STR and CoStar Group, he has played a central role in launching CoStar Group products across global markets, executing and integrating acquisitions, scaling international operations and advancing strategic initiatives that have strengthened the Company's competitive position. Prior to joining STR, Rossmann spent 13 years at Deloitte, where he served as a Senior Director advising many of the world's leading public and private real estate and hospitality companies across the United States, the United Kingdom and other international markets. His experience included financial assurance, internal controls and risk management, financial and commercial due diligence, capital markets transactions, debt advisory, valuation, business planning and investment appraisal. Mr. Rossmann is a Chartered Accountant (South Africa) and a graduate of Stellenbosch University.

In connection with Mr. Rossmann’s appointment, the Company entered into an offer letter agreement with him, pursuant to which, following the Effective Date, he will be entitled to receive an annual base salary of £440,000, which will transition to $590,000 upon his relocation to Arlington, VA (which is expected to occur following receipt of U.S. work authorization and on or before December 31, 2026). He will be eligible to receive an annual incentive bonus opportunity with a target of 100% of base salary. Additionally, Mr. Rossmann is entitled to receive a one-time equity grant (“Additional 2026 Equity Award”) under CoStar Group, Inc.’s 2025 Stock Incentive Plan (the “Plan”) valued at $2,500,000 as of July 31, 2026 (“Grant Date”). Consistent with the equity awards granted in 2026 to other executive officers of the Company, the Additional 2026 Equity Award will be structured as follows: (i) 40% in restricted stock units that vest in three equal, annual installments on or around the anniversary of the Grant Date, and (ii) 60% in the form of performance stock units that vest on the date that the Compensation Committee of the Board determines the extent to which the applicable performance metrics for the 2026 – 2028 performance period have been satisfied, in each case, subject generally to continued employment. The Additional 2026 Equity Award will be subject to the terms and conditions of the Plan and award agreements thereunder. In connection with his relocation to the United States upon receiving U.S. work authorization, Mr. Rossmann will be eligible to receive relocation services (with an additional payment for out-of-pocket tax costs) and a cash relocation subsidy equal to $500,000 in the aggregate (less applicable taxes and withholdings), which will be payable subject to continued employment in good standing.

Mr. Rossmann will also be eligible to participate in the Company’s Executive Severance Plan, as may be amended from time to time, on the same terms and conditions as the Company’s other “Executive Officers” (as defined therein).

The foregoing descriptions of the offer letter agreement and the Executive Severance Plan do not purport to be complete and are qualified in their entirety by reference to the full text of the offer letter agreement (which will be filed as an exhibit with the Company’s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q for the quarterly period ending September 30, 2026) and the Executive Severance Plan.

On July 7, 2026, Christian Lown, Chief Financial Officer (Principal Financial Officer) of the Company, informed the Company of his decision to resign, effective July 31, 2026, for another opportunity outside the Company’s industry. Mr. Lown has advised the Company that his resignation was not a result of any disagreement with the Company on any matter related to the Company’s operations, policies or practices.

CoStar Group Promotes Robin Rossmann to Chief Financial Officer to Drive Margin Expansion and Profitable Growth Rossmann, CoStar Group's Managing Director, Europe, brings more than two decades of financial and operational leadership — over the past two years reducing the Company's European cost structure by 25% while delivering double-digit revenue growth and launching CoStar in France ARLINGTON, Va., July 13, 2026 — CoStar Group, Inc. (NASDAQ: CSGP), a leading provider of online real estate marketplaces, information, and analytics in the property markets, today announced the appointment of Robin Rossmann as Chief Financial Officer, effective July 31, 2026, succeeding Christian Lown, who is stepping down to pursue an opportunity outside the Company's industry. Rossmann will report to Andy Florance, Founder and Chief Executive Officer of CoStar Group. Rossmann will lead CoStar Group's global finance organization, overseeing the Company's financial and operational performance, capital allocation, financial planning and investor engagement as CoStar Group continues to expand its global platforms, increase profitability and create long-term value for shareholders. Rossmann currently serves as CoStar Group's Managing Director, Europe, and is a member of the Company's executive leadership team. Over the past two years, he has distinguished himself by dramatically improving the margins of CoStar Group's European business — eliminating approximately $51 million in costs, roughly 25% of the European cost structure — while delivering double-digit revenue growth and launching CoStar in France. Rossmann joined STR in 2016, leading its businesses across EMEA, Asia Pacific and Latin America, and became part of CoStar Group through the Company's acquisition of STR in 2019. Over the past decade with STR and CoStar Group, he has played a central role in launching CoStar Group products across global markets, executing and integrating acquisitions, scaling international operations and advancing strategic initiatives that have strengthened the Company's competitive position. "Robin is a rare executive who combines deep financial expertise with proven operating leadership and a demonstrated ability to dramatically reduce costs while accelerating growth," said Andy Florance, Founder and Chief Executive Officer of CoStar Group. "During his time with CoStar Group, he has consistently delivered outstanding operating performance across our international businesses — driving strong organic revenue growth, expanding margins, successfully integrating acquisitions and launching our products in new markets. Robin knows our business, strategy and culture exceptionally well, and is deeply respected across our leadership team. I look forward to partnering with him as we sharpen our focus on margin expansion and profitable growth." "CoStar Group has built one of the strongest and most differentiated real estate technology companies in the world," said Rossmann. "I am honored to assume the role of Chief Financial Officer at such an exciting point in the Company's evolution. I look forward to partnering with Andy, our leadership team and our employees to drive disciplined capital allocation, enhance operational efficiency, expand margins and support continued profitable growth while delivering long-term value for our shareholders." Prior to joining STR, Rossmann, a Chartered Accountant, spent 13 years at Deloitte, where he served as a Senior Director advising many of the world's leading public and private real estate and Ex. 99.1

hospitality companies across the United States, the United Kingdom and other international markets. His experience included financial assurance, internal controls and risk management, financial and commercial due diligence, capital markets transactions, debt advisory, valuation, business planning and investment appraisal. Lown will step down as Chief Financial Officer effective July 31, 2026. His departure was not the result of any disagreement with the Company relating to the Company's operations, policies or practices.
